Description
Munto rules the Magical Kingdom, a celestial realm teetering on collapse as its lifeblood—Akuto, energy born from human emotions and wishes—steadily diminishes. Confronting the imminent destruction of both his world and Earth, he descends to seek Yumemi Hidaka, a mortal girl uniquely attuned to the Heavens, convinced her latent power can reignite the fading Akuto and mend the fractured balance between dimensions. His desperation is rooted in ancestral failures: centuries ago, his predecessors plundered Akuto from parallel realms, severing ties with Earth and trapping the Heavens in isolation, a decision now hurtling both worlds toward mutual ruin.

A solitary monarch burdened by prophecy, Munto initially clings to the counsel of his advisor Ryuley, who foretold Yumemi’s role in averting catastrophe. His early demeanor blends regal authority with abrasive urgency, demanding her aid while obscuring the full gravity of their plight. Yet as celestial islands crumble and political adversaries like Gntarl’s United Army resist his plans—fearing interdimensional chaos—he gradually sheds his lone-sovereign mindset. Forced to confront collapsing alliances and eroding trust among his people, he learns to lean on Yumemi’s empathy and her profound bond with Akuto, recognizing her not as a tool but a partner.

The weight of legacy haunts him: the scars of past rulers’ greed, the withering skies above his throne, the whispers of dissent among his subjects. Through clashes with rival factions and the unraveling fabric of reality itself, Munto’s arc pivots from rigid self-sufficiency to tempered interdependence. He accepts that salvation lies not in dominion but in unity, bridging the chasm between Heaven and Earth through shared sacrifice. By aligning with Yumemi and her allies, he confronts his lineage’s hubris, trading isolation for collaboration—and in doing so, kindles a fragile hope that both realms might yet endure.
